Output 705f3e447ae4b446c833acd7d809d0ca5cade01ea9ebaed3c2f9366d8799e54b:0

value
599814203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4cc6ec398f2ccc84d29b790d0947f85b8d231fa OP_EQUAL
address
3KdbGNd1NboEmk1k6DHVBLNwAwHG1a9QK1
transaction
705f3e447ae4b446c833acd7d809d0ca5cade01ea9ebaed3c2f9366d8799e54b
spent
true